Where is Newfield?
Where is Newfield located?
Newfield, St. Philip County, Antigua and Barbuda (approx. 17.03333°, -61.73333°)
Where is Newfield on the map?
Newfield - Bethesda
Newfield - Clarence House
{"latitude":17.03333,"longitude":-61.73333,"title":"Newfield"}